今天在对CopyOnWriteArrayList进行排序操作时代码报错,错误信息如下:
java.lang.UnsupportedOperationException
at java.util.concurrent.CopyOnWriteArrayList$COWIterator.set(CopyOnWriteArrayList.java:1049)
at java.util.Collections.sort(Collections.java:159)
at com.cdsoft.epcp.android.InstanceManagerAndroidController$1.run(InstanceManagerAndroidController.java:532)
具体原因是CopyOnWriteArrayList不支持Collections.sort()方法。
我的解决方法如下:
List<String> endTimeList = new CopyOnWriteArrayList<>();
List<String> endTimeTempList = new ArrayList<>(endTimeList);
Collections.sort(endTimeTempList);
其他方法参考文章:
1. http://blog.csdn.net/u011001723/article/details/46431575;
最新评论
网飞没问题, 迪士尼+有解决方案么?
pp助手是安卓手机用的,根本下载用不来苹果
已解决
这样的话数据库里的结构为{"attachment":{"content":"xxx"}}, 要怎么才能变成{"content":"xxx"},从而使结构保持一致?
赞! make test不过的坑都写到的,谢谢楼主~
谢谢你
用了root用户还是一直502是怎么回事呢
student id 是空的